PDA

View Full Version : سوال: مشکل آپدیت خودکار فیلدها



ahmadflasher
یک شنبه 25 فروردین 1392, 21:27 عصر
سلام . من یه دیتابیس دارم که یکی از جدولهاش مربوط به مشتریان هستش که تو این جدول 4 تا فیلد از نوع int دارم که یکی id هستش که auto increment و کلید اصلی و 3 تای دیگه معمولی هستن. مشکل اینجاست که هر یک ماه یا دو ماه این 3 فیلد در یک یا دو رکورد به صورت خودکار مقدارشون صفر میشه.یعنی مقدار قبلی شون عوض میشه. خط به خط برنامه رو بازبینی کردم و مطمئن شدم که برنامه اینکارو نمیکنه و یک جای کارم تو طراحی دیتابیس مشکل داره.از دوستان کسی نمیدونه مشکلش چیه؟؟
چطوری میتونم یک فیلد تعریف کنم که مقدارش همیشه بزرگتر از 0 باشه؟؟

SilverLearn
یک شنبه 25 فروردین 1392, 21:35 عصر
موقع ساخت فیلد مورد نظرت باید خاصیت NULL رو به اون اضافه کنی
چون اگر اینکار رو نکنی چون فیلد از نوع int هست میاد و به صورت خودکار اگر چیزی داخل فیلد ریخته نشه عدد 0 رو جایگزین می کنه...

ahmadflasher
یک شنبه 25 فروردین 1392, 21:55 عصر
موقع ساخت فیلد مورد نظرت باید خاصیت NULL رو به اون اضافه کنی
چون اگر اینکار رو نکنی چون فیلد از نوع int هست میاد و به صورت خودکار اگر چیزی داخل فیلد ریخته نشه عدد 0 رو جایگزین می کنه...
یعنی اگه null کنم دیگه 0 نمیگیره؟؟

ahmadflasher
دوشنبه 26 فروردین 1392, 07:42 صبح
کسی نیست جواب مارو بده ؟؟؟!! :افسرده: